How To Grow Garlic In Water For An Endless Suppl

Growing garlic at home is one of the simplest and seemingly magical endeavors. Today, we’ll guide you on cultivating garlic without soil—right in water.

How often have you found yourself with slightly aged garlic, already sprouting new shoots? Follow these instructions carefully to learn how to cultivate garlic in water.

  1. Select Sprouting Garlic Cloves: Choose garlic cloves that have already started to sprout. Opt for the healthiest cloves, ensuring they are not rotten or damaged.
  2. Place in a Glass or Jar: Put the sprouting garlic cloves in a glass or a glass jar with the sprout end facing upward.
  3. Add Room Temperature Water: Pour room temperature water into the glass, covering the garlic cloves halfway. Be cautious not to submerge them entirely, as this may lead to rotting.
  4. Sunlit Windowsill Placement: Position the glass or jar on the inner sill of a window for 4-7 days, ensuring it receives ample sunlight.
  5. Monitor and Change Water: Keep an eye on the water, and if it becomes too dark, change it. To do this, remove the garlic cloves with clean hands, empty the glass, reposition the cloves, and add fresh water.
  6. Grow Garlic Shoots: Allow the garlic shoots to grow to a height of approximately 7 cm or more. These garlic shoots can be utilized for cooking or as a flavorful addition to dishes.
